A right cylindrical tank with a total volume of 5,000 cubic units has an interior diameter of 20 units. the volume gauge indicates that the tank is 60% full. to the nearest 5 units, what is the interior height of the fluid in the tank?

    Total volume of the tank is 5000 cubic units

    Volume of liquid=60%*5000=3000 cubic units

    the height of the fluid will be found as follows

    V=πr²h

    where:

    r=20/2=10 units

    hence:plugging in the values and solving for h we get:

    3000=π * (10²) * h

    thus

    h=3000 / (100π)

    h=9.5292966

    h=9.5293 units
